Transaction 51450e11b1f0d12ad44b46d4d977b59be40906a47d3a315bb180436377c8f88d
1 Input
1 Output
-
51450e11b1f0d12ad44b46d4d977b59be40906a47d3a315bb180436377c8f88d:0
- value
- 1327574
- script pubkey
- OP_0 OP_PUSHBYTES_20 18fbba30514ea0fda9babb762ad9422fd316efcc
- address
- bc1qrram5vz3f6s0m2d6hdmz4k2z9lf3dm7vdwulev